实验家兔常用经穴的客观检测与标定

摘    要:目的 客观确定家兔“十四经”常用经穴。方法 应用皮肤电阻导电量测定及声测经络技术 ,将导电量较大、声波波幅值较高点确定为经穴点。并通过经穴—脏腑效应实验 ,验证其生理功能。结果 家兔经穴皮肤导电量较经穴旁对照点大 ( P<0 .0 1) ;声波波幅值较经穴旁对照点高 ( P<0 .0 1) ;经穴能够产生脏腑效应。结论 经穴与人体经穴具有相同的生物物理学特性 ,并有相应的生理功能 ,有类似人体的经穴

Objective Detection and Labeling of the Common Acupoints in Rabbits

Abstract:Objective To objectively determine the common meridian-acupoints in rabbits.Methods The subcutaneous electric resistance and sound wave were detected, and the spots with higher electric conductivity and higher sound amplitude were defined as acupoints, whose physiological functions were verified through acupoint-organ relationship.Results In rabbits, the electric conductivity at the acupoints was higher than the control spots beside them (P<0.01); the sound amplitude at the acupoints was higher than the control spots beside them (P<0.01); the acupoints had certain relation with their corresponding organs. Conclusion The rabbits possess acupoints similar to the ones in the human body in biophysics and physiology.
